    Lampanelli married in 1991 and divorced soon afterward. [1] She married Jimmy Cannizzaro, a former tavern owner from Valley Stream, New York, on October 2, 2010, at the New York Friars' Club. [1] [31] In May 2014, she filed for divorce from Cannizzaro after three and a half years of marriage. [32] Lampanelli is a supporter of the LGBTQ+ ...

    Gregory Carlos Giraldo (December 10, 1965 – September 29, 2010) was an American stand-up comedian, television personality, and lawyer.He is remembered for his appearances on Comedy Central's televised roast specials, and for his work on that network's television shows Tough Crowd with Colin Quinn, Lewis Black's Root of All Evil, and the programming block Stand-Up Nation, the last of which he ...
